FREDERICK, Md., Nov. 3, 2016 /PRNewswire/ -- U.S. Silica Holdings, Inc. SLCA today announced a net loss of $11.3 million or $(0.17) per basic and diluted share for the third quarter ended Sept. 30, 2016 compared with net income of $2.4 million or $0.05 per basic share and $0.04 per diluted share for the third quarter of 2015. The third quarter results were negatively impacted by $4.7 million of business development-related expense, including acquisition-related costs for Sandbox and NBR Sands. Excluding these expenses, net of $1.8 million tax effect, EPS was $(0.13) per basic share for the quarter.

"Our team showed tremendous discipline and determination during the quarter to successfully integrate two major acquisitions while continuing to move our base businesses forward," said Bryan Shinn, president and chief executive officer. "With the additions of Sandbox and NBR Sands, we can further maximize value for our Oil & Gas customers by having the widest raw sand product offering of anyone in our industry and the only commercially viable last-mile containerized delivery solution. On the industrial side, we continue to benefit from the inherent value of ISP to generate consistent cash flows to cover fixed costs in a downturn while providing a platform for growth going forward."

Third Quarter 2016 Highlights

Total Company

  • Revenue totaled $137.7 million compared with $155.4 million for the same period last year, a decrease of 11% on a year-over-year basis and an increase of 18% sequentially compared with the second quarter of 2016.
  • Overall tons sold totaled 2.5 million, down 5% compared with the 2.6 million tons sold in the third quarter of 2015 and an increase of 11% sequentially from the second quarter of 2016.
  • Contribution margin for the quarter was $19.7 million, down 46% compared with $36.5 million in the same period of the prior year but up 27% sequentially from the second quarter of 2016.
  • Adjusted EBITDA was $8.3 million compared with Adjusted EBITDA of $24.0 million for the same period last year, a decrease of 66% on a year-over-year basis and an increase of 54% sequentially compared with the second quarter of 2016.

Oil and Gas

  • Revenue for the quarter totaled $86.8 million compared with $102.0 million in the same period in 2015, a decrease of 15% on a year-over-year basis and an increase of 34% sequentially from the second quarter of 2016.
  • Tons sold totaled 1.6 million, essentially flat compared with 1.6 million tons sold in the third quarter of 2015 and up 21% sequentially compared with the tons sold in the second quarter of 2016.
  • 65% of tons were sold in basin compared with 61% sold in basin in the third quarter of 2015, and 55% sold in basin in the second quarter of 2016.
  • Segment contribution margin was a loss of $1.9 million versus a profit of $16.5 million in the third quarter of 2015, an increase of 68% sequentially compared with the second quarter of 2016.

Industrial and Specialty Products

  • Revenue for the quarter totaled $51.0 million compared with $53.4 million for the same period in 2015, a decrease of 5% on a year-over-year basis and a decrease of 2% on a sequential basis from the second quarter of 2016.
  • Tons sold totaled 0.876 million, a decrease of 13% on a year-over-year basis and a decrease of 3% on a sequential basis compared with the second quarter of 2016.
  • Segment contribution margin was $21.6 million compared with $20.0 million in the third quarter of 2015, an increase of 8% on a year-over-year basis and flat sequentially compared with the second quarter of 2016.

Capital Update

As of Sept. 30, 2016, the Company had $264.1 million in cash and cash equivalents and $46.0 million available under its credit facilities. Total debt at Sept. 30, 2016 was $506.6 million. Capital expenditures in the third quarter totaled $9.4 million and were associated largely with the Company's investments in various maintenance, expansion and cost improvement projects.

Outlook and Guidance

Due to the current lack of visibility in its Oil and Gas business, the Company will continue to refrain from providing guidance for Adjusted EBITDA until such time as it can gain more clarity around our customers' business activity levels and the associated demand for our products. Based on current market conditions, the Company anticipates that its capital expenditures for 2016 will be in the range of $42 million to $47 million.

About U.S. Silica

U.S. Silica Holdings, Inc., a member of the Russell 2000, is a leading producer of commercial silica used in the oil and gas industry, and in a wide range of industrial applications. Over its 116-year history, U.S. Silica has developed core competencies in mining, processing, logistics and materials science that enable it to produce and cost-effectively deliver 235 products to over 1,200 customers across our end markets. The Company currently operates nine industrial sand production plants, nine oil and gas sand production plants and seven Sandbox distribution centers. The Company is headquartered in Frederick, Maryland and also has offices located in Chicago, Illinois, and Houston, Texas.

Non-GAAP Financial Measures

Segment Contribution Margin

Segment contribution margin is a key metric that management uses to evaluate our operating performance and to determine resource allocation between segments. Segment contribution margin excludes certain corporate costs not associated with the operations of the segment. These unallocated costs include costs related to corporate functional areas such as sales, production and engineering, corporate purchasing, accounting, treasury, information technology, legal and human resources.

Adjusted EBITDA

Adjusted EBITDA, a non-GAAP measure, is included in this release because it is a key metric used by management to assess our operating performance and by our lenders to evaluate our covenant compliance. Adjusted EBITDA excludes certain income and/or costs, the removal of which improves comparability of operating results across reporting periods. Our target performance goals under our incentive compensation plan are tied, in part, to our Adjusted EBITDA. In addition, our revolving credit facility (Revolver) contains a consolidated total net leverage ratio that we must meet as of the last day of any fiscal quarter whenever usage of the Revolver (other than certain undrawn letters of credit) exceeds 25% of the Revolver commitment, which is calculated based on our Adjusted EBITDA. Noncompliance with the financial ratio covenant contained in the Revolver could result in the acceleration of our obligations to repay all amounts outstanding under the Revolver and the term loan. Moreover, the Revolver and the term loan contain covenants that restrict, subject to certain exceptions, our ability to make permitted acquisitions, incur additional indebtedness, make restricted payments (including dividends) and retain excess cash flow based, in some cases, on our ability to meet leverage ratios calculated based on our Adjusted EBITDA.

Adjusted EBITDA is not a measure of our financial performance or liquidity under GAAP and should not be considered as an alternative to net income (loss) as a measure of operating performance, cash flows from operating activities as a measure of liquidity or any other performance measure derived in accordance with GAAP. Additionally, Adjusted EBITDA is not intended to be a measure of free cash flow for management's discretionary use, as it does not consider certain cash requirements such as interest payments, tax payments and debt service requirements. Adjusted EBITDA contains certain other limitations, including the failure to reflect our cash expenditures, cash requirements for working capital needs and cash costs to replace assets being depreciated and amortized, and excludes certain non-recurring charges that may recur in the future. Management compensates for these limitations by relying primarily on our GAAP results and by using Adjusted EBITDA only supplementally. Our measure of Adjusted EBITDA is not necessarily comparable to other similarly titled captions of other companies due to potential inconsistencies in the methods of calculation.
